Abstract
The solubility of carbon in bcc Fe and fcc Co-Ni alloys has been examined by the diffusion couple method, and a thermodynamic analysis of the data has been carried out, taking into account the effect of magnetic transition. It has been detected that the solubility slightly deviates from the ordinary linear relation between log [pct C] and 1/T below the Curie point. The deviation has been well explained by the magnetic effect on the Gibbs energy for the bcc Fe-C and fcc Co-Ni-C phases.
